A vertical spring of force cosntant `100 N//m` is attached with a hanging mass of 10 kg. Now an external force is applied on the mass so that the spring is stretched by additional 2m. The work done by the force F is `(g = 10 m//s^(2))`

A

200 J

B

400 J

C

450 J

D

600 J

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A
